Day to day
- The Product Marketing Intern will support the Product Marketing team by performing analyses of go-to-market performance and business opportunities in the market.
- This person also conducts research on competitor behavior and build buyer insights to understand buyer personas.
- Compile analysis and financial models on customer trends and historical data to support decision-making.
- Lead the development and execution of ad-hoc analysis to support data-driven pricing initiatives.
- Conduct periodic analysis on the performance of existing products to identify areas for improvement.
- Support the development and curation of marketing collateral by conducting research.
